After age 65, the risk-to-benefit equation for routine medical screenings changes significantly because many conditions identified in older adults will never cause harm, the body's tolerance for medical intervention decreases, and the cascade effect (where one test triggers a chain of unnecessary procedures) becomes more likely; therefore, patients should ask five key questions before any screening: the false positive rate for their age, realistic treatment options at their age, procedural risks of treatment, what happens if monitoring instead of immediate treatment, and the most effective non-invasive approach.
